Victogón is indicated for the treatment of erectile dysfunction in adult men. This occurs when a man cannot obtain or maintain a firm erection, adequate for satisfactory sexual activity. Victogón has demonstrated significant improvement in the ability to achieve a lasting erection of the penis adequate for sexual activity.
Victogón contains the active ingredient tadalafil, which belongs to a group of medications called phosphodiesterase type 5 inhibitors. After sexual stimulation, Victogón acts by helping to relax the blood vessels in the penis, allowing blood flow to the penis. The result is an improvement in erectile function. Victogón will not help if you do not have erectile dysfunction.
It is essential to warn you that Victogón is not effective if there is no sexual stimulation. Therefore, you and your partner should stimulate each other in the same way as you would if you were not taking a medication for erectile dysfunction.

If you experience a sudden decrease or loss of vision or your vision is distorted, blurred while taking Victogón, stop taking this medication and contact your doctor immediately.
A sudden decrease or loss of hearing has been observed in some patients taking tadalafil. Although it is not known if the event is directly related to tadalafil, if you experience a sudden decrease or loss of hearing, stop taking Victogón and contact your doctor immediately.
Victogón is not intended for use in women.
Victogón should not be used in children or adolescents under 18 years of age.

Information about the effect of alcohol can be found in section 3. Grapefruit juice may affect the proper functioning of Victogón and should be taken with caution. Consult your doctor for more information.
In dogs treated with tadalafil, a decrease in sperm production by the testicles was observed. A reduction in sperm has been observed in some men. It is unlikely that these effects will produce a lack of fertility.
Some men who took Victogón during clinical trials experienced dizziness. Carefully check how you react when taking the tablets before driving or using machines.
This medication contains lactose. If your doctor has told you that you have an intolerance to certain sugars, consult with them before taking this medication.
This medication contains less than 1 mmol of sodium (23 mg) per tablet; this is, essentially "sodium-free".

Victogón tablets are for oral administration only in men. Swallow the tablet whole with a little water. The tablets can be taken with or without food.
The recommended initial doseis one 10 mg tablet before sexual activity. However, you have been given a dose of one 20 mg tablet because your doctor has decided that the recommended dose of 10 mg is too weak.
When taking Victogón, you can initiate sexual activity at least 30 minutes after taking it.
Victogón may still be effective up to 36 hours after taking the tablet.
Do not take Victogón more than once a day. Victogón 10 and 20 mg will be used before expected sexual activity and are not recommended for continuous daily use.

Consuming alcohol may affect your ability to have an erection and may temporarily lower your blood pressure. If you have taken or are planning to take Victogón, avoid excessive alcohol consumption (blood alcohol level of 0.08% or higher), as it may increase the risk of dizziness when standing up.

Myocardial infarction and stroke have also been reported rarely in men taking tadalafil. Most of these men had pre-existing heart problems before taking this medication.
Rare cases of decreased or lost vision, partial, transient, or permanent in one or both eyes have been reported.

In men over 75 years of age treated with tadalafil, the most frequently reported side effect was dizziness. In men over 65 years of age treated with tadalafil, the most frequently reported side effect was diarrhea.

Victogón 20 mg are film-coated tablets of yellow color, elliptical, biconvex, and marked with "T20" on one side.
Victogón 20 mg is available in blister packs with 2, 4, 8, 10, or 12 tablets.
